What is a dementia program coordinator?

A Dementia Program Coordinator is a professional responsible for developing, implementing, and overseeing programs tailored to individuals living with dementia. They work in healthcare facilities, senior living communities, or community organizations to ensure that activities and care plans meet the unique cognitive and emotional needs of dementia patients. Their duties often include staff training, coordinating therapeutic activities, supporting families, and ensuring compliance with relevant health regulations. The goal is to enhance the quality of life for those with dementia by providing structured, compassionate care and support.

How does a dementia program coordinator typically collaborate with healthcare teams and families to support individuals living with dementia?

A Dementia Program Coordinator works closely with interdisciplinary healthcare teams, including nurses, therapists, and social workers, to develop and implement individualized care plans for residents or clients. They also serve as a key point of contact for families, providing education, updates, and emotional support. Effective collaboration and communication are essential, as the coordinator must balance clinical recommendations with family input to ensure the best quality of life for those living with dementia. This role often involves facilitating regular meetings and training sessions to keep all stakeholders informed and aligned.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a dementia program coordinator,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Dementia Program Coordinator, you need a background in healthcare, gerontology, or social work, often with a relevant degree or certification in dementia care. Familiarity with care planning software, documentation systems, and dementia-specific training such as Certified Dementia Practitioner (CDP) is typically expected. Compassion, strong leadership, and excellent communication skills set outstanding coordinators apart, enabling them to support both residents and staff effectively. These competencies are vital for ensuring high-quality, person-centered care and enhancing quality of life for individuals living with dementia.

The Dementia Program Coordinator and Memory Care Coordinator roles both focus on supporting seniors with cognitive impairments. The main difference lies in their scope: the Dementia Program Coordinator oversees broader dementia-related initiatives across various settings, while the Memory Care Coordinator specializes in managing memory care units within assisted living facilities. Both roles require relevant certifications and work in healthcare or senior living environments, but their specific responsibilities and settings differ slightly.

The Reminiscence Coordinator leads the memory care neighborhood, ensuring residents living with Alzheimer's and other forms of dementia receive compassionate, individualized care and meaningful engagement. This role champions Sunrise's Resident-Centered Care model while supporting families and developing a strong, well-trained team.What You'll Do: Lead daily operations of the reminiscence neighborhood in compliance with regulations and Sunrise standards Champion the designated care manager model and Life Skills programming Develop and facilitate dementia-appropriate activities that create purposeful, pleasant days Partner with clinical leadership to ensure ISPs, safety, hydration and care needs are met Support families through meetings, education and monthly support groups Monitor quality indicators including weight management, behaviors and medication oversight Manage staffing, scheduling, training and performance management Oversee department budget and financial performance Ensure regulatory compliance and risk management standardsReminiscence Coordinator - Lead Compassionate Memory Care and Meaningful Resident EngagementMemory Care Coordinator | Dementia Care | Alzheimer's Care | Senior Living | Life Enrichment | Resident Engagement
